How Does WTF Ublocked Work?
To understand how WTF Ublocked functions, it's essential to explore the different techniques used to bypass restrictions. Here are some of the most popular methods:
- VPNs (Virtual Private Networks): VPNs create a secure connection between your device and the internet, allowing you to change your IP address and access restricted content.
- Proxy Servers: A proxy acts as an intermediary between your device and the internet, enabling you to access blocked sites without revealing your identity.
- Tor Browser: This specialized browser routes your internet traffic through multiple servers, providing anonymity and access to restricted content.
- Browser Extensions: Certain extensions can help bypass content restrictions directly from your web browser.

What Are the Risks of Using WTF Ublocked?
While the desire to access blocked content is understandable, there are inherent risks involved. These include:
- Legal Consequences: As mentioned earlier, depending on your location, accessing restricted content may lead to fines or other legal actions.
- Security Risks: Using unreliable VPNs or proxies can expose users to data breaches or malware.
- Loss of Privacy: Some free services may log user activity or sell data to third parties.
